Kinnikinnick, the low-growing evergreen shrub anchoring the northern wilderness.
If you look closely at the rocky outcrops and sandy clearings of Melgund Township right now, you will spot clusters of tiny, pink-tipped bells dangling beneath leathery green leaves. This is Bearberry (Arctostaphylos uva-ursi), a remarkably tough, trailing evergreen shrub that thrives where other plants fail.
While it looks like a delicate woodland flower, bearberry is actually a woody powerhouse. Its ground-hugging, mat-forming growth habit keeps it safely beneath the worst of the biting northern winds, allowing it to carpet the Canadian Shield in a vibrant, year-round blanket of green.
The most striking feature of bearberry in late May is its uniquely shaped blossoms. These “urceolate” (urn-shaped) flowers look like miniature upside-down vases. This narrow-mouthed design is a clever evolutionary defense mechanism; it effectively protects the plant’s precious nectar and pollen from heavy spring rains and freezing temperatures. Because the opening is so tight, it requires specialized pollinators—like heavy native bumblebees—who use “buzz pollination” to vibrate the flower at just the right frequency to release the pollen inside.
Beyond its neat design, bearberry holds deep ecological and cultural significance. Its scientific name, uva-ursi, literally translates to “grape of the bear,” hinting at the bright red berries that will replace these pink bells by late summer. These berries persist well into winter, providing a critical survival food source for bears, grouse, and small mammals when other resources vanish. Culturally, Kinnikinnick has been used for centuries by Indigenous peoples in traditional smoking mixtures and medicinal teas. On top of that, its extensive, matting root systems act as nature’s anchor, preventing soil erosion along Ontario’s rugged, sandy slopes.
